With the development of communication technology and the Internet of things,smart home has been developing rapidly,and has gradually penetrated into the lives of ordinary people.Because of the high pursuit of people's quality of life,the research of smart home has become a hot topic.Since the first intelligent summer designed by the United States,smart home has attracted people's attention.The arrogant design cost of smart homes has greatly constrained the development,but with the development of communication technology and the popularity of mobile smart phone,it has brought great vitality to the smart home.Smart home has broad application prospects.Therefore,research and development of smart home is in line with the needs of contemporary social development.Based on the WIFI technology and the Raspberry Pi platform,this paper designs the smart control of the light and curtain motor for the mobile terminal and the computer terminal,respectively.The main work includes the following:First of all,wireless communication technology is more cost-effective and convenient than wired communication technology.The system is based on the Raspberry Pi 3B.It uses the Raspberry Pi on-board wireless network interface module to connect with the laboratory's WIFI network,plus the corresponding peripheral circuits to control the full-color LED.A mobile phone mobile app is designed to intelligently control the brightness and color changes of the LED.Then,the computer interface is designed,and the function interface of the control motor is programmed.The computer interface is installed safely,ensuring the security of the system application.The motor control uses wiring PI to drive the GPIO pins,occupying 6 pins in total,2 for outputting the PWM signal,and 4 for outputting the control signal.The LM293 motor control board is used to drive the motor.Two A58SW31 worm gear motors are used.The PWM sets the speed adjustment of the 10 speed motor and the forward and reverse direction drive functions.Finally,the function test and performance test of the system are carried out.The test results show that the system is stable and reliable,and the whole system meets the requirements of the initial design,which proves that the system has great application value.
